In 1902, Geiger started studying physics and mathematics at the University of Erlangen and was awarded a doctorate in 1906. He was an outstanding teacher, capable of enthusing his students. In 1912 Geiger returned to Germany as director of the new Laboratory for Radioactivity at the Physikalisch-Technische Reichsanstalt in Berlin, Germany, where he invented an instrument for measuring not only alpha particles but other types of radiation (the giving off of energy and particles from atoms) as well. Hans Geiger, byname of Johannes Wilhelm Geiger, (born September 30, 1882, Neustadt an der Haardt, Germanydied September 24, 1945, Potsdam), German physicist who introduced the first successful detector (the Geiger counter) of individual alpha particles and other ionizing radiations.
